AMC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

160 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AMC Entertainment Holdings (AMC)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$571M — up 16% from $494M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 38 funds closed out of AMC and 30 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 38 trimmed existing stakes and 67 added.

The largest buyer was Greenvale Capital, adding an estimated $12.8M. The largest seller was PKO Investment Management Joint-Stock, cutting an estimated $11.3M.
